Auction: 23126 - Spink Numismatic e-Circular 30: English and World Coins and Medals - e-Auction
Lot: 8755

George III (1760-1820), 'New Coinage' Sixpence, 1816, laureate head right, rev. crowned shield within Garter, milled edge, 12h, 2.79g (ESC 1630; Bull 2191; Spink 3791), a couple of contact marks to the cheek, otherwise with a most pleasing lustre to the fields, nearing uncirculated; 'New Coinage' Sixpence, 1817, milled edge, 12h, 2.86g (ESC 1632; Bull 2195; Spink 3791), lustrous and toned to the obverse, about extremely fine; Sixpence, 1819, small 8, milled edge, 12h, 2.81g (ESC 1636A; Bull 2202), the 8 and 9 repunched, cleaned, otherwise very fine; Sixpence, 1820, milled edge, 12h, 2.83g (ESC 1638; Bull 2205; Spink 3791), attractively toned, about as struck (4)
